TraAshia Gillespie Obituary

TraAshia Gillespie SUMMERVILLE - The relatives and friends of Ms. TraAshia Gillespie who entered into eternal rest on Monday, March 23, 2015, and those of her parents, Stephen & Wanda Manigault and Troy Gillespie; those of her children, Jaiden Gillespie and Christopher "CJ" Carroll; and those of her siblings, Breonna McSwain, Jamar, Janeice, Alexis, and Ambria Gillespie are invited to attend her home going celebration on Saturday, March 28, 2015, 11:00AM at Charity Missionary Baptist Church, 1544 E. Montague Ave., N. Charleston, SC; Rev. Dr. Nelson B. Rivers, III, Pastor. Interment will follow at Sunset Memorial Garden. Ms. Gillespie will repose from 6:00PM - 8:00PM on Friday, March 27, 2015 at the Mortuary. Memorial messages may be sent to the family at www.hiltonsmortuary.com.
